Comprehending Trauma
Trauma is classified into 2 primary types:
Acute trauma: Results from a single stressful event, such as a mishap or a natural catastrophe.Persistent trauma: Arises from prolonged direct exposure to stressful events, such as continuous abuse or living in a battle zone.
Terrible experiences can result in numerous mental health conditions, consisting of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D), anxiety, depression, and attachment disorders. A reliable assessment can assist determine the presence and seriousness of these conditions.

The mental health assessment process for trauma encompasses numerous actions. Below, a breakdown of these elements is presented.
1. Initial Evaluation
The initial evaluation generally includes:
Clinical interviews: A mental health professional takes part in a discussion to comprehend the person's history, consisting of the traumatic experience, current signs, and coping systems.Self-report questionnaires: Various standardized tools assist clients disclose their signs and experiences more conveniently.2. Standardized Assessment Tools
Mental health professionals utilize different standardized assessment tools customized for trauma-related conditions. Some typically used instruments consist of:
Assessment ToolDescriptionClinician-Administered PTSD Scale (CAPS)A structured interview designed for PTSD diagnosis.PTSD Checklist for DSM-5 (PCL-5)A self-report scale utilized to examine PTSD symptoms.Trauma History QuestionnaireA structured form that collects in-depth trauma exposure info.Beck Depression Inventory (BDI)Evaluates the existence and seriousness of depression.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7-item (GAD-7)Screens for basic anxiety signs.3. Physical and Biological AssessmentsPhysical health evaluation: Health care providers may examine physical conditions that might worsen mental health signs.Biological markers: Blood tests or other biological assessments can assist rule out physical problems adding to emotional distress.4. Social and Environmental Assessment
Understanding an individual's social support group and environmental stress factors is crucial. Experts may examine:
Support network: The availability of household, buddies, and community resources.Living conditions: Current living circumstance and direct exposure to continuous stressors or safety concerns.5. Creating a Diagnosis
Based on the collected information, mental health professionals develop a diagnosis, if appropriate, which can guide the subsequent treatment approach.
Treatment Options Following Assessment
Once a mental health assessment is total, numerous treatment alternatives may be executed. Here is a list of common techniques:
